Can greek tortoises live outside. Greek tortoises live in southern Europe North Africa and southwest Asia. There are many of them on the coast of the Black Sea coast in the Caucasus from Russian Anapa to Abkhazia Sukhumi in the south and also Georgia Azerbaijan and Armenia. The ones in North Africa live in semi-arid scrub brush and grassland and areas in the Atlas Mountains and are also found among coastal dunes rocky.

Housing Greek tortoises outdoors in a naturalistic pen is always best. During the warmer part of the year they can be kept in spacious enclosures that are well planted with edible vegetation and receive plenty of time in natural full sun.
Indoors the construction of a tortoise table will suit the needs of Greek tortoises well. Greek tortoises are best suited for warmhot climates. When taking care of them therefore one of the major concerns should be the habitat that you create.
If you have a garden area and the temperature during the day and night is warm enough then you can create an enclosure outside. Indoors the construction of a tortoise table or tortoise house will suit the needs of Greek tortoises well. A 3-by-6-foot unit made of plywood will suffice for a single adult and up to a pair of adults.
Using real untreated wood is always recommended over plastic or glass. We do this so that the tortoises cannot see through the habitats walls. This will also enable them to learn their boundaries and eventually they will.
As always natural sunlight should be utilized whenever possible and the tortoises fully benefit in many ways from being exposed to it. Construct walls from cinder block or solid wood leaving no space where tortoises can see through to the outside. Tortoises who can see through to the other side of the fence become obsessed with escaping their enclosure.
Large tortoises such as sulcatas can push through wire mesh and chain-link fencing. Testudo graeca subspecies are known to be some of the longest-lived of the tortoises. Reports suggest well into the 100s.
In the wild many do not live past the age of 20 due to predation and other factors. When kept safe and under optimum conditions Greek tortoises thrive and can live to a ripe old age. Greek Tortoise Behavior and Temperament.
Like many pet reptiles Greek tortoises prefer not to be handled by humans. Handling is very stressful for tortoises and it can have a negative impact on their health. Some tortoises might even bite if picked up.

Greeks are fairly small tortoises and therefore only require a small habitat at full maturity of say 35 though larger is always better. Multiple female Greek tortoises may be housed together in groups of up to 6 but size should be 45 cubic feet larger per female.

Ibera Greek Tortoise Temperature. Young Greek tortoises should be kept with an ambient temperature of 86 degrees. A cold spot of 80 is fine and a warm spot of 95 is also nice however the ambient temp remains the most important.
